Yes, and it's a terrible school ("citation needed"). There are also other schools (like ETNA for example) where the teachers are almost non-existant, your teachers are the students of last year, (you actually pay for this, it's not public schools).

Engineering schools do not have a lot of teachers in France, I don't understand where you get that from.

Thank you for the downvote. Sorry but I am just telling the truth. If you have any counter arguments, please tell them, I would be happy to learn something about the tech schools in my country.

